Identity theft is one of the fastest growing way to steal your money and important information for the perfect alternative and innocent strangers. Non-profit Identity Theft Resource Center, defines it as “divided into four categories: Money Identity Theft (using another name and SSN to obtain goods and services), Criminal Identity Theft (posing as another when attached a crime), Identity Cloning (using another information to assume his identity in everyday life) and Business / Industrial Identity Theft (using another company to receive credit). “
